1.) A firm with market power faces the following demand and cost.

P = 60 - Q Cost = 0.5Q ^2 (no fixed cost)

MC = Q

a) If the firm does not price discriminate, what quantity will it produce and what price will it charge? What will be the firm's profit?

b) What will be the firm's profit with perfect price discrimination?

c) To implement perfect price discrimination you will have to use salespersons. What is the maximum amount total you will spend on salespersons?

2. The demand of a typical consumer for a good is given by

P = 15 - Q

The firm's cost is given by Cost = 0.5Q^ 2 (no fixed cost)

MC = Q

a) Charging only one price, what will be the firm's profit earned from a typical consumer (find Q, P, then profit)

b) Using two-part pricing , what will be the entry (membership) fee? What will be the per-unit fee?

c) Compute the profit earned from a typical consumer with two-part pricing. Hint: same as perfect price discrimination profit.
